PENGU's 90% Price Surge: Decoding Retail Investor Momentum and Short-Term Trading Implications


The Pudgy PenguinsPENGU-- (PENGU) token has captured the attention of crypto markets and retail investors alike, surging 90% in the past week and retesting the $0.029 level-a price not seen since mid-January 2025, according to a CCN analysis. This dramatic move, driven by a 6.3x increase in capital inflows and an 8.78% drop in exchange supply, the CCN analysis notes, has pushed PENGUPENGU-- into the top 60 tokens by market cap, surpassing established names like FilecoinFIL-- (FIL) and FETFET--, as the CCN piece also observes. While institutional narratives often dominate crypto analysis, the current rally in PENGU underscores a critical but underappreciated force: the resurgence of retail investor momentum in digital assets.

Retail Investor Behavior: A Catalyst for PENGU's Surge
Retail investor activity has long been a double-edged sword in financial markets, capable of both amplifying trends and creating speculative bubbles. In 2025, this dynamic appears to be playing out anew. According to a report by JPMorgan Chase, U.S. retail investment volumes in Q1 2025 grew 13% year-over-year, with younger and lower-income demographics driving much of the inflow, per WorldCoinIndex. This trend has carried into Q3 2025, as evidenced by PENGU's trading volumes. For instance, a single day in August 2025 saw $528 million in PENGU trading volume, while January's 24-hour surge hit $907 million, according to BeInCrypto. The PENGU token's performance on retail-focused exchanges further reinforces this narrative. Binance alone recorded $1.03 billion in PENGU trading volume during Q3 2025, with Bitget and OKX contributing $500 million and $465 million, respectively, data from WorldCoinIndex show. Such concentrated activity on platforms popular with retail traders suggests that PENGU has become a focal point for speculative capital. This is not merely a function of liquidity; it reflects a cultural shift. The Pudgy Penguins NFT ecosystem, for example, saw a 38% increase in weekly transactions and a 400% rise in trading volume, WorldCoinIndex reports, indicating that PENGU's appeal extends beyond pure speculation to a community-driven narrative.
On-Chain Metrics and Whale Activity: Fueling the Fire
While retail sentiment is a key driver, PENGU's rally has also been amplified by on-chain metrics and whale behavior. Open Interest (OI) in PENGU derivatives has climbed to $430.47 million, the CCN analysis reports, a level that suggests strong conviction among leveraged traders. Meanwhile, whale activity has surged, with large investors acquiring $240 million in PENGU tokens over the past week, per an OKX analysis. This accumulation, combined with a 13% increase in whale holdings reported by WorldCoinIndex, signals that institutional and high-net-worth actors are aligning with retail momentum-a rare convergence that often precedes significant price moves.
Technical indicators further validate the bullish case. PENGU's Chaikin Money Flow (CMF) reached 0.27, the CCN piece shows, a level typically associated with strong buying pressure. Additionally, the token's price action has formed a bull flag pattern, breaking through key resistance levels as the CMF and Awesome Oscillator (AO) confirm upward momentum, according to OKX. These signals, while technical in nature, are amplified by retail-driven volume surges, creating a self-reinforcing cycle of demand.
Short-Term Trading Implications
For short-term traders, PENGU's current trajectory presents both opportunities and risks. The token's recent 54% weekly jump (OKX reported) and 230% three-week trading volume increase, per WorldCoinIndex, suggest that momentum is still intact. However, the absence of clear regulatory clarity-despite speculation about a potential ETF listing on the Cboe exchange noted by WorldCoinIndex-introduces volatility. Traders should monitor two key metrics:
- Open Interest and Funding Rates: A sustained increase in OI above $430 million, as reported by CCN, and positive funding rates (BeInCrypto noted) could indicate continued long-position dominance. Conversely, a sharp decline in OI might signal profit-taking or a reversal.
- Whale Activity: Large investors have historically acted as a barometer for market sentiment. If whale accumulation slows or reverses, it could trigger a correction.
Retail traders may also benefit from leveraging PENGU's correlation with broader market trends. The S&P 500's all-time highs in 2024 and early 2025, highlighted by BeInCrypto, coincided with a surge in retail investment transfers, suggesting that PENGU's rally is part of a larger trend of risk-on behavior. However, this also means the token is vulnerable to macroeconomic shifts, such as rising interest rates or political uncertainties that dampened Q1 2025 retail volumes by 7%, WorldCoinIndex reports.
